Support for Linux Alpine OS

Description

A user recently enquired about Node.js SDK compatibility with Alpine OS, including prebuild support.

At this point we think there shouldn't be any issues, having said that we also know this has not been tested. A regression on Alpine OS needs to happen to assert that it works on this platform.
